Amazon Web Services (AWS) is seeking a talented, technically experienced, and self-motivated Sr. Environmental Development and Permitting Manager to support AWS Manufacturing, Test, and Operations (MOTO) facilities. The successful candidate will join the AWS Environmental team — an expanding and dynamic team that is critical to enabling AWS’s growth around the world, as well as ensuring regulatory compliance and the highest-level environmental performance of AWS’s manufacturing operations. This role sits within the MOTO Environmental organization and serves as the strategic owner for new site environmental development, environmental permitting across all MOTO facilities, environmental playbook development, and advisory support to EMEA/APAC regional teams. Under this development and permitting umbrella, the role is also the team’s senior technical subject matter expert (SME) for waste program management, environmental reporting, permitting strategies, and emergency response and spill prevention planning across all MOTO manufacturing facilities. As the strategic owner of environmental development and permitting for the MOTO portfolio, you will define and lead the environmental permitting strategy for new site activations and facility expansions — developing replicable permit application frameworks. You will own the environmental compliance program playbook from pre-deployment assessment through operational steady-state, and serve as the technical advisor to EMEA/APAC regional Environmental Managers. You will drive cross-organizational influence across Manufacturing Operations, Real Estate & Facilities, Legal, Supply Chain, and Sustainability teams — influencing without authority at senior levels and building durable technical programs that outlast any individual initiative. This role has three onsite locations: Seattle, WA; IAD (Herndon, VA); and CVG (Florence, KY) — with a preferred location of CVG, tied to the manufacturing facility that is the primary initial focus of the MOTO Environmental compliance program. Key job responsibilities 1. New Site Environmental Development - Own the strategic environmental development program for new MOTO manufacturing sites — defining permitting readiness frameworks, compliance architecture, and activation-to-steady-state transition protocols for rapid facility expansions. 2. Drive the multi-year environmental compliance roadmap, identifying gaps ahead of planned manufacturing phases and building programs proactively before capacity constraints emerge. 3. Provide strategic technical guidance on new manufacturing processes, materials, and chemistries for regulatory implications prior to deployment. 4. Environmental Permit Management Lead environmental permitting strategy across all MOTO facilities — setting standards for permit applications, regulatory applicability determinations, agency engagement, and permit conditions management. 5. Serve as senior technical authority for air quality, water quality, hazardous materials permitting, and RCRA compliance across the portfolio. 6. Develop scalable, replicable permitting frameworks that accelerate environmental authorization with each successive build phase. 7. Define waste characterization protocols, regulatory applicability frameworks, and disposal pathway standards for manufacturing waste streams. Own the technical strategy for waste characterization, profiling, and RCRA compliance across all MOTO manufacturing sites. 8. Emergency Response & Spill Prevention - Develop and maintain emergency response plans, SPCC plans, and contingency plans for all MOTO manufacturing facilities. Lead spill incident reporting, root cause analysis, and corrective action oversight across the portfolio. Advisory Support to EMEA/APAC Serve as technical advisor to regional teams 9. Cross-Functional Integration & Leadership Drive integration between Environmental and Manufacturing Operations, Real Estate, Legal, Supply Chain, and Sustainability
